Output 8d176611e6061af00b8229ded6d9f62312feca17a6a69c7f457411ddbe3ceaec:0

value
510270301
script pubkey
OP_0 OP_PUSHBYTES_20 e5dbccc74494b4aed1a54ed84c1d30ecbf3ec07a
address
ltc1quhdue36yjj62a5d9fmvyc8fsajlnasr6q3jgqd
transaction
8d176611e6061af00b8229ded6d9f62312feca17a6a69c7f457411ddbe3ceaec
spent
true